Not even Chinese pirates want Samsung’s Galaxy Gear smartwatch

17
Jan
2014

The Galaxy Gear is so unpopular that when CNN visited the epicenter of Chinese counterfeit electronics, they could not find one Galaxy Gear knockoff. “[Counterfeiters] don’t care about the Gear as consumer demand is too weak,” said one shop assistant. “We don’t sell it anymore. It was not popular.” CNN visited 20 shops in Shenzhen’s Huaqiangbei commercial district and none of them sold a counterfeit Galaxy Gear. “I’ve never seen a knock-off Gear in this whole town,” said one woman whose shop actually sells the real Galaxy Gear. “They don’t sell well.” China’s counterfeit shops are often leading indicators of what tech gadgets will be popular.
